Postby Zorro2109 » Tue Apr 10, 2012 8:20 pm

I thought I'd give an update on the clunking noise from the front struts, it has now completely disappeared, and I have no idea why.
I'm guessing that the struts are using a different section that wasn't being lubricated properly prior to the new springs.
Either way the noise is gone and I'm happy.

Parramatta Road isn't too bad, slightly rougher and a little bouncier, but I can live with that. :D

I have been told that its the bilsteins that 'dry' out. Go get some spray lube and jack the car up and spray the shaft and your done. May have to do this every once in a while. I was told this by my mechanic as i had the same noise, quick spray and bobs your uncle. I actually noticed on little bumps that the suspension absorbed it better or softer ...
